Summary

Under the supervision of the Practice Administrator, the Practice Supervisor provides tactical leadership to maximize the effectiveness of all service delivery systems and financial performance, engages staff and cultivates a clinic culture that prioritizes patient‑centric care. Coordinates day‑to‑day operational aspects of multiple clinics and works closely with staff and providers to ensure fiduciary and clinic goals are met.

Responsibilities
  • Assign duties and examine work for accuracy, timeliness, and conformance to department standards.
  • Orient and train new employees; maintain and develop skill levels of current employees; provide written and oral instruction.
  • Identify problem areas such as understaffing, customer complaints, and inefficiencies; take corrective action as needed.
  • Model, maintain, and promote customer service skills and standards.
  • Support established processes and systems to enhance customer service by providing coaching to staff and ensuring a safe environment for patients, staff, providers and visitors, and operating clinic in compliance with all legal and regulatory requirements.
  • Assist in managing the revenue cycle and support management of supply costs, track inventory usage, use purchasing information management systems, including maintaining staffing levels that adhere to labor standards and effectively controlling staff premium pay.
  • Coach, evaluate, and recognize staff; initiate disciplinary action when necessary.
  • Assist in determining workload priorities to enable timely completion of tasks while monitoring work performance and providing training and coaching as necessary.
  • Direct and assist staff in conflict resolution and act as an information resource.
  • Perform or assist subordinates in performing duties.
  • Maintain employee attendance records; verify employee time sheets and submit to payroll.
  • Responsible for all personnel related duties: counseling, interviewing, hiring, and termination as needed.
  • Ensure all expired sample medication and/or patient supplies are discarded upon expiration.
  • Participate in work groups, teams, task forces, and committees to support ongoing improvement in clinic operations.
  • Other duties as assigned.
Qualifications

Education: High School Diploma or GED required.

Experience: Minimum of 3 years in related field, minimum 2 years supervisory experience, working knowledge of ambulatory care operations.
